Nat Sherman is a brand of natural "luxury cigarettes", packaged and marketed to a higher-class clientele than most cigarettes. The company, headquartered in New York City, also sells cigars, pipe tobacco, and accessories. Nat Sherman has been selling tobacco since 1930. Nat Sherman is also one of the most famous cigar manufacturers in the United States having provided cigars to gentlemen's clubs throughout New York City for 75 years. The boxes of the company note that the headquarters are located on Fifth Avenue, New York City, and currently include, as well as a retail section, a smoking lounge, and is stocked with various memorabilia relating to the company's history.

Common current cigarette product lines include:

  • Nat Sherman Classic
  • Nat Sherman Classic Mints
  • Nat Sherman Classic Lights
  • Nat Sherman "Specialties": (longer and thinner than the "Classics", these are "Queen Size", but with the same cigarette-grade tobacco as the "Classics".)
  • Nat Sherman "Black and Gold" - colored black with gold leaf filters.
  • Nat Sherman "Fantasias" (the same cut as "Black and Golds", "Fantasias" have recently become popular with "alternative" life-style crowds due to their rainbow-colored paper wrappings.)
  • Nat Sherman "New York Cuts", which are available in all the varieties of the "Classics", but are of the same length and width of most common American "premium" brands.
  • Nat Sherman "MCD"'s, which are of the same cut as the "Specialties", but are made of cigar-grade tobacco, and come in:
    • MCD King - the same cut as Nat Sherman "Classics", but with MCD tobacco.
    • MCD's
    • MCD's Lights Brown
  • Nat Sherman Naturals

(Nat Sherman "Classic" cigarettes in "Queen Size")

  • Nat Sherman Naturals Light - with a "unique filtration system."
  • Nat Sherman Naturals Mint
  • Nat Sherman Naturals Original - Nat Sherman "Classics" in a "Queen Size."
  • Nat Sherman Originals (This brand is generally considered to be a MCD with various alterations/filters, though some do disagree and believe it also has a different quality of tobacco and/or paper from the MCD's.)
  • Nat Sherman Non-Filter Cigaretellos Brown - Cigar-grade tobacco in a paper wrapping, without a filter.
  • Nat Sherman "A Hint Of Mint" - Nat Sherman-specific mint filter
  • Nat Sherman "A Touch of Clove" - The same design as "A Hint Of Mint", with clove-flavored crystals in the filter.
  • Nat Sherman "Havana Ovals" - Cigar-grade tobacco without filter. They are oval shaped, and originally made with Havana tobacco.

Nat Sherman also carries cigarillos, cigars, and various smoking implements.
